Hi has anybody any ideas on how to immobilise a MK 111 fiesta cheaply, like having a hidden switch some where inside the car.Many thanks

just what you said really, a hidden switch. Can either disable the starter circuit or the coil. Will be just as good as any off the shelf immobiliser until someone figures out where the switch is or which circuit has been immobilised.
If it was on a bmw or lambo, i'd suggest something a bit more elaborate, but as it's a fiesta..........
 
Cut the ignition live on the back of your ignition (blackbox) extend the cable and add your switch to where you want it.Just make sure that the cable and switch are rated to the same volts/amps as the ignition live.Your haynes manual should have a wiring guide for the ignition with colour codes.Oh and most important thing, Disconect your battery before you cut any cables and solder and heatshrink all your new joints.
The alternative is to buy one of those aftermarket db7 starter button kits? same concept and you get all the parts with it + wiring diagram.Cost around £15-£20 I think.
